Physical therapy

Physical therapy can help patients reduce pain and improve or restore mobility. In many cases, expensive and risky surgical intervention can be avoided, and the need for long-term use of prescription medications—their side effects—can be lessened.

Physical therapy can help the patient prevent or manage his or her condition so that long-term health benefits can be achieved. Scheurer Hospital's physical therapists examine each individual and develop a treatment plan according to the patient's goals, such as promoting the ability to move, restoring function, reducing pain or preventing disability. Services include an individualized evaluation, patient-centered intervention using a variety of treatment techniques, and periodic re-evaluation of the progression toward meeting the client's goals.

Occupational therapy

Occupational therapy can help patients achieve independence in all areas of their lives. Patients work to restore independence with activities of daily living (ADLs) and work skills. Services include an individualized evaluation, patient-centered intervention using a variety of treatment techniques, and periodic re-evaluation of the progression toward meeting the client's goals.

Athletic training

Athletic training deals with physical fitness and treatment and the prevention of injuries related to sports and exercise. Athletic training professionals treat patients who participate in sports just for fun or who want to get better results from their exercise program, patients who suffered injuries and want to regain full function, and patients who have disabilities and want to increase their mobility and capabilities.

Swim-Ex Resistance Pool

Scheurer Hospital has the only Swim-Ex Resistance Pool within a 50-mile radius. The principles of water (buoyancy, hydrostatic pressure and viscosity) provide physiological and clinical benefits to the patient. The aquatic therapy program may be chosen by your therapist to complement and accelerate your rehabilitation process.

Biodex Balance System SD

Scheurer Hospital is pleased to introduce the Biodex Balance System SD. This state-of-the-art balance unit is used for both testing and training during the rehabilitation of a variety of balance impairments. Documented feedback is provided to the patient, which compares his or her performance to peers in his or her age group. Most patients report noticing significant results within six to eight weeks utilizing a combination of conventional therapy methods with the Biodex Balance System SD.
